基于CentOs的docker的安装和简单使用
1、安装
官方安装步骤:https://docs.docker.com/get-started/overview/
1、卸载
sudo yum remove docker \docker-client \docker-client-latest \docker-common \docker-latest \docker-latest-logrotate \docker-logrotate \docker-engine
2、使 用 仓 库 进 行 安 装
sudo yum install -y yum-utils
添加仓库
sudo yum-config-manager \--add-repo \https://download.docker.com/linux/centos/docker-ce.repo
3、安 装 d o c k e r 引 擎
sudo yum install docker-ce docker-ce-cli containerd.io
4、启动docker
sudo systemctl start docker
5、验 证 d o c k e r 引 擎 是 否 安 装 完 毕
sudo docker run hello-world
2、docker启动相关命令
1、查看下载的镜像列表
docker images
2、重新加载docker(重新加载后台进程)
sudo systemctl daemon-reload
3、重启docker
sudo systemctl restart docker
4、配置docker国内镜像地址(加快镜像下载速度)
sudo mkdir -p /etc/docker
sudo tee /etc/docker/daemon.json <<-'EOF' {
"registry-mirrors":
["https://aa25jngun.mirror.aliyuncs.com"]
}
EOF
sudo systemctl daemon-reload
sudo systemctl restart docker
3、docker基础命令
可 以 通 过 官 网 查 看 相 关 命 令
官网文档链接: https://docs.docker.com/reference/
常 用 基 础 命 令
# 查看版本 docker version
# 显示docker的信息 docker info
# 帮助 docker [命令] --help
#查看容器 docker ps [-a] -a查看所有容器,不加-a查询的是正在运行的容器
#查看容器top信息 docker top [容器id]
#查看容器元数据信息 docker inspect [容器id]
#将主机中的文件拷贝到容器中 docker cp SRC_PATH [容器id]:DEST_PATH
#将容器中的文件拷贝到主机中 docker cp [容器id]:DEST_PATH SRC_PATH
#查看容器状态 docker stats
#进入容器 docker attach [容器id]
# 方法1 退出后docker ps 进程还在
docker exec -it [容器id] /bin/bash
# 方法2 退出后 进程也会自动退出
docker attach [容器id]
常 用 容器 命 令
#运行容器 docker run [可选参数] image
#查询容器列表 docker ps [OPTIONS]
#退出容器 exit、CTRL+D、 CTRL+P+Q
#删除容器 docker rm [OPTIONS] 容器id ...
#启动&重启容器 docker start [容器id] 、docker restart [容器]
#停止正在运行的容器 docker stop [容器id]
#强制停止运行中的容器 docker kill [容器id]
基于CentOs的docker的安装和简单使用相关推荐
- Linux发行版CentOS下Docker的安装和卸载
目录 1.Docker的安装 2.Docker的卸载 linux中安装docker的方式有几种,本文是基于docker仓库的安装 前置须知: 本文的服务器并非虚拟出来的服务器,而是在阿里云ESC上进行 ...
- CentOS上Docker的安装卸载及Docker简介
文章目录 docker的安装 Linux设备要求 1.安装相关编译环境 2.安装Docker 3.启动和停止 测试hello-world 卸载Docker docker简介 什么是docker Doc ...
- 53.Azure中CentOS的Docker里安装运行SQL Server容器
大家熟悉SQL Server可以安装在Windows系统上,我也介绍了SQL Server可以安装在LInux上,那么今天我将给大家介绍SQL Server安装在Docker上成为容器快速运行起来 首 ...
- 云计算 docker的安装及简单使用
四.结合自己电脑的操作截图,编写docker使用手册 Docker 是一个开源的软件部署解决方案. Docker 包括三个基本概念:镜像(Image)容器(Container)仓库(Repositor ...
- Centos 下Docker容器安装vim
背景 使用docker来安装虚拟机可以提升安装效率和开发效率. 本次在安装了jenkins之后,突然忘记密码了. 需要修改config.xml文件来重新登录 进去之后发现死活不能使用vim 用yum安 ...
- docker 的安装以及简单centos镜像制作、启动
1.安装docker [root@iZ2ze82p1dogve7neb5tuoZ ~]# yum install docker 2.查看 docker 是否成功 [root@iZ2ze82p1dogv ...
- 基于centos 安装配置Docker ssl
基于centos 安装配置Docker ssl Docker SSL配置 生成证书 配置Docker启用TLS 测试 参考 Docker SSL配置 记录基于centos配置docker ssl访问 ...
- Docker的安装和使用及dockerfile简单使用
Docker的安装和使用及dockerfile简单使用 一.简介 Docker是一个基于go语言的开源的应用容器引擎,可以将开发者的应用及依赖包打包到一个可移植容器当中,然后发布到任何流行的Linux ...
- Docker的安装、镜像源更换与简单应用
Docker的安装.镜像源更换与简单应用[阅读时间:约20分钟] 一.概述 二.系统环境&项目介绍 1.系统环境 2.项目的任务要求 三.Docker的安装 四.Docker的简单应用 1. ...
最新文章
- maven显示1.5版本过期的解决办法
- 利用JQuery插件CleverTabs实现多页签打开效果
- pandas 替换 某列大于_Pandas简单入门 1
- ajax修改属性后如何遍历,Ajax遍历jSon后对每一条数据进行相应的修改和删除(代码分享)...
- linux下常用压缩(compress ,gz ,bzip2,xf)命令和打包命令(tar,zip)详解
- ddr3配置 dsp6678_简简单单学TI 多核DSP(2):TMS320C6678的时钟配置
- 简单迭代法和牛顿迭代法matlab程序设计(含例题)
- 畅谈无线通信系统物理层之系统概述
- 很清晰的解读i2c协议
- e480Linux无法发现无线网卡,ThinkPad无线不能用无法连接无线网络的具体排查流程图解...
- myeclipse设置黑色主题
- Linq的where语句中如果有两个条件以上的写法
- WPS使用宏操作——减少重复性操作,提高效率
- Material Design系列,自定义Behavior实现Android知乎首页
- 本门藏经阁 - AndroidX
- WP免费主题,wordpress免费主题,WP建站主题
- jsp393学生宿舍管理系统mysql
- 中国二次锂离子电池电解液市场需求现状与销售策略分析报告2022-2028年
- Python学习笔记——流程控制(拉勾教育数据分析实战训练营学习笔记)
- 用java定义中国象棋的棋子_java大神 求帮忙 我坐的中国象棋怎样移动棋子